Shutter Staining Questions
What causes shutter staining? Shutter staining is often caused by prolonged exposure to moisture, dirt, or environmental pollutants that lead to discoloration on the surface of shutters.
Can shutter staining be removed? Yes, staining can typically be cleaned or treated to restore the appearance of shutters, depending on the severity and type of stain.
Are certain shutter materials more prone to staining? Wooden shutters are more susceptible to staining from moisture and dirt, while vinyl or composite shutters tend to resist staining better.
How can staining be prevented? Regular cleaning and maintenance, along with protecting shutters from excessive moisture and dirt, can help prevent staining over time.
